I've been using this for quite a while and everything seems to work except the jetways. The manual says that jetways at stands 33, 17 and 12 can be 'activated' by changing NAV1 frequency. This doesn't work in my system at those stands.
Has anyone else had this problem? Any suggestions how to activate. BTW Gatwick jetways don't work either.
